MANUFACTURED GAS

Particular gas mixtures obtained by (1) thermal decomposition of oil, known as a petroleum gas), (2) destructive distillation of coal, known as coal gas, or (3) steam reaction as it passes through a bed of heated coal or coke, known as water gas.
